// REINDEX_BATCH_CAP limits docs per shard pass in the Tallowfield
// nightly search reindex. Raising it starves the ingest queue;
// lowering it overruns the maintenance window. 5000 is the tested
// sweet spot. Change only with a soak run. Verified against the
// build noted below.

session token of bawif-hahog = htk6_ac5981

Handover — Pennoway flag rollout framework, on-call week 31. Current state: the staged rollout for the checkout flags is paused at 25% after an evaluation-latency spike; dashboards look stable since Tuesday. If the flag store loses quorum again, follow the restore steps in the runbook: stop the evaluators, promote the standby, then unseal the flag vault before resuming traffic. The unseal prompt expects the standing recovery passphrase, noted below for convenience.

unlock words, kawig-bawef: belax-sorir-druax-ulaiel-wenael-belael

## Gateway Rate Limits

The Harrowmint gateway enforces per-team token buckets: 500 req/s default, burst 2x. On-call can raise limits temporarily via the `limits override` command; overrides expire in four hours. Never disable limiting globally — downstream services will fall over. Override commands must be signed before the gateway accepts them, using the key below.

release key, kahif-yagap: bky3_1JN